			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Medicare Part B covers medically-necessary services and some preventive services that aren&#8217;t covered by Medicare Part A. If you enroll in Part B, Medicare will pay 80% of the &#8220;reasonable charge&#8221; for covered services after you&#8217;ve met the deductible for that year. You are responsible for paying the other 20% (co-insurance).</p>
<p>Medicare has a defined &#8220;reasonable charge&#8221; for services that might be less than what the doctor charges. In that case, you&#8217;ll be responsible for paying 20% plus the difference between the actual cost of service and Medicare&#8217;s reimbursement. Some doctors may accept assignment, meaning they&#8217;ll only charge Medicare&#8217;s &#8220;reasonable charge&#8221; for services, forcing you to pay the 20% co- insurance.</p>
<p>You are responsible for paying the Part B premium each month. The standard premium is $96.40. You might have to pay a higher premium based on your income if you file single on your tax return and your modified adjusted gross income (MAGI) is higher than $85,000. For married filing jointly, the MAGI limit is $170,000. Individuals and couples who exceed the minimum income limits could pay as much as $308.30 a month.</p>
<p>If you get Social Security or Retired Railroad Board (RRB) benefits, you&#8217;ll automatically receive Part B on the first day of the month you turn 65. Your Medicare card will come in the mail 3 months before your 65th birthday. If you are under 65, you will receive Part B after you&#8217;ve received disability benefits from Social Security or RRB for 2 years. Your Medicare card will come in the mail on the 25th month of your disability.</p>
<p>Though you are automatically enrolled in Part B under the previously mentioned circumstances, you don&#8217;t have to keep it. If you don&#8217;t want Part B, your card will come with instructions on cancelling it. Follow those instructions and send the card back. If you keep the card, you will pay Medicare part B premiums. Premiums are automatically deducted from your Social Security or RRB benefits.</p>
<p>If you would like to receive Part B, but you aren&#8217;t receiving Social Security or RRB benefits, you can sign up during the initial enrollment period which starts 3 months prior to you turning 65 and ends 3 months after you turn 65. You could also sign up for Part B during the general enrollment period from January 1 to March 31 each year and your coverage will begin on July 1 of that year. Also, if you missed the signup during your initial enrollment period, you could face a 10% increase in your monthly premium.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>If you are considering buying life insurance coverage, an overview of the available kinds need to demonstrate helpful. This article will in brief go over the main difference among complete and term, along with some variants upon whole life.</p>
<p>The easiest way to know the main difference in between whole life insurance and also term life insurance would be to take a look at what&#8217;s intended by their titles. When you obtain whole life, you are addressing your &#8220;whole&#8221; existence &#8211; so long as you own the protection, it&#8217;ll spend an advantage whenever you die. What in which advantage is actually depends upon the need for the protection at the time of your death, however, you very own the protection even if you&#8217;re will no longer making payments onto it. Very existence additionally accumulates any funds value over a tax-deferred basis. Furthermore, very existence will pay rewards through the entire life of the protection.</p>
<p>Term life, however, is actually bought for a particular expression, or even time period. As long as you die within in which time period, term will pay a great decided add up to your own receivers. It won&#8217;t spend if you end to produce payments or perhaps if you pass away after the phrase offers expired. Furthermore, term life does not have any money benefit.</p>
<p>A couple of other aspects of complete as opposed to term life insurance ought to be pointed out. The initial factor is that rates with regard to whole life are usually greater to start with, but remain steady as time passes. On the other hand, rates regarding term life are reduce near the start of the plan, but improve with time. Another element is that you can use from the cash value of a whole life insurance policy. No chance together with term life, since it doesn&#8217;t have a money value. There are 2 versions associated with whole life insurance that need to become described. The first is a far more versatile kind of whole life referred to as universal insurance coverage. Together with general life insurance coverage, you can change (inside of specific restrictions) the monthly premiums plus the advantage quantity over time to suit your finances. This is granted by inserting the particular monthly premiums in a fund that accumulates in line with the interest rate. Much like normal life insurance coverage, this kind of policy features a funds worth that can be borrowed in opposition to.</p>
<p>The second deviation on whole life is called adjustable life insurance. This sort resembles universal insurance coverage, except that the rates inside the fund are linked with the actual real estate markets rather than to rates of interest. Even though the possibility of growth is actually greater with this type of insurance policy, the opportunity of reduction is actually greater as well.</p>

<p>Application forms will need to be filled out. Honesty is always the best policy in filing these forms. All present medical problems need to be listed along with the medications you take and why you take them. Some conditions are considered preexisting and there may be a waiting period required before they will be covered. Your final choice will be based on cost and the amount of coverage you will receive for the premium you have to pay.</p>
<p>Check out all providers in your area. Talk with them and see what they offer in coverage. The first thing you will notice is that they are all different. It is up to the individual to make the final decision which policy best fits their needs for the money paid in premiums. Depending on your income situation you may be eligible for acceptance in a state run Medicaid or age related Medicare program. Never make a final decision without first exploring every option that possibly suits your needs.</p>
<p>Your next option is to look over the different plans offered by each company. There are many options in plans and it will make a difference in your final decision. How much of your doctor visits will be covered; in hospital patient payments; and prescription drugs are all questions that must be answered. Some people would rather pay more out of pocket and a smaller premium, while others will pay the largest premium for the best coverage.</p>
<p>The present trend in out of control medical costs have caused many health coverage companies to raise their rates continually. One possible way of reducing premiums is to join a group that offers medical coverage. Some such plans are offered by local Chambers of Commerce and even credit unions are beginning to offer them. Membership will require a small fee but typically it lowers your premium considerably.</p>
<p>Temporary insurance is another option for some. People who are temporarily laid off, others who are seasonal employees, or a child reaching an age where the parents policy no longer covers them, are all examples. Short term policies are designed to get you over the rough spots. Rates are lower and coverage is adequate.</p>
<p>COBRA, or Consolidate Omnibus Budget Reconciliation Act, covers a number of people. Impending job dismissal would fall into this group. Contacting your employer will let you know if this coverage is available through your position. It is not free medical coverage but lasts longer than other short term policies staying in effect for about eighteen months. This is typically ample time for other employment to be found.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Medicare is our only national health insurance program, serving over 44 million Americans. The program provides health benefits to almost 7 million people younger than 65 who have a disability or chronic condition. <p>These people are entitled to Medicare primarily through the qualification for their Social Security Disability Insurance (SSDI) benefits, or because they have End Stage Renal Disease (ESRD), or Amyotrophic Lateral Sclerosis (ALS), known as Lou Gehrig&#8217;s disease. <p>Disabled and blind Americans receive monthly Social Security or Supplemental Security Income payments.</p>
<p>Also, people in the United States also receive help from Medicare and Medicaid, which helps pay medical bills. Many people that do suffer from disabilities want to work.</p>
<p>There are also work incentives with Social Security. One of these is the Ticket to Work program. Keeping your cash benefits and medical coverage while you are getting to work is one such incentive.</p>
<p>This program can help you obtain vocational rehabilitation, job referrals and other employment support services, free of charge.</p>
<p>All of these services are provided by employment networks. Employment networks are private organizations or government agencies that work with Social Security.</p>
<p>They provide employment services and other support to beneficiaries with disabilities, and state vocational rehabilitation agencies.</p>
<p>The program is 100% voluntary. If you think you are not able to work, you do not have to take part in this. It will also not affect you&#8217;re disability benefits.</p>
<p>There are many incentives to this program. Such are cash benefits while you work, Medicare or Medicaid while you work, and help with extra work expenses.</p>
